Lines Matching refs:cpus_allowed

105 	cpumask_var_t cpus_allowed;  member
415 return cpumask_subset(p->cpus_allowed, q->cpus_allowed) && in is_cpuset_subset()
433 if (!alloc_cpumask_var(&trial->cpus_allowed, GFP_KERNEL)) in alloc_trial_cpuset()
438 cpumask_copy(trial->cpus_allowed, cs->cpus_allowed); in alloc_trial_cpuset()
443 free_cpumask_var(trial->cpus_allowed); in alloc_trial_cpuset()
456 free_cpumask_var(trial->cpus_allowed); in free_trial_cpuset()
514 cpumask_intersects(trial->cpus_allowed, c->cpus_allowed)) in validate_change()
528 if (!cpumask_empty(cur->cpus_allowed) && in validate_change()
529 cpumask_empty(trial->cpus_allowed)) in validate_change()
542 !cpuset_cpumask_can_shrink(cur->cpus_allowed, in validate_change()
543 trial->cpus_allowed)) in validate_change()
579 if (cpumask_empty(cp->cpus_allowed)) { in update_domain_attr_tree()
703 if (!cpumask_empty(cp->cpus_allowed) && in generate_sched_domains()
705 cpumask_intersects(cp->cpus_allowed, in generate_sched_domains()
906 cpumask_and(new_cpus, cp->cpus_allowed, parent->effective_cpus); in update_cpumasks_hier()
930 !cpumask_equal(cp->cpus_allowed, cp->effective_cpus)); in update_cpumasks_hier()
938 if (!cpumask_empty(cp->cpus_allowed) && in update_cpumasks_hier()
973 cpumask_clear(trialcs->cpus_allowed); in update_cpumask()
975 retval = cpulist_parse(buf, trialcs->cpus_allowed); in update_cpumask()
979 if (!cpumask_subset(trialcs->cpus_allowed, in update_cpumask()
980 top_cpuset.cpus_allowed)) in update_cpumask()
985 if (cpumask_equal(cs->cpus_allowed, trialcs->cpus_allowed)) in update_cpumask()
993 cpumask_copy(cs->cpus_allowed, trialcs->cpus_allowed); in update_cpumask()
997 update_cpumasks_hier(cs, trialcs->cpus_allowed); in update_cpumask()
1278 if (!cpumask_empty(cs->cpus_allowed) && in update_relax_domain_level()
1345 if (!cpumask_empty(trialcs->cpus_allowed) && balance_flag_changed) in update_flag()
1475 (cpumask_empty(cs->cpus_allowed) || nodes_empty(cs->mems_allowed))) in cpuset_can_attach()
1479 ret = task_can_attach(task, cs->cpus_allowed); in cpuset_can_attach()
1762 seq_printf(sf, "%*pbl\n", cpumask_pr_args(cs->cpus_allowed)); in cpuset_common_seq_show()
1950 if (!alloc_cpumask_var(&cs->cpus_allowed, GFP_KERNEL)) in cpuset_css_alloc()
1956 cpumask_clear(cs->cpus_allowed); in cpuset_css_alloc()
1966 free_cpumask_var(cs->cpus_allowed); in cpuset_css_alloc()
2027 cpumask_copy(cs->cpus_allowed, parent->cpus_allowed); in cpuset_css_online()
2028 cpumask_copy(cs->effective_cpus, parent->cpus_allowed); in cpuset_css_online()
2061 free_cpumask_var(cs->cpus_allowed); in cpuset_css_free()
2071 cpumask_copy(top_cpuset.cpus_allowed, cpu_possible_mask); in cpuset_bind()
2074 cpumask_copy(top_cpuset.cpus_allowed, in cpuset_bind()
2093 set_cpus_allowed_ptr(task, &current->cpus_allowed); in cpuset_fork()
2122 BUG_ON(!alloc_cpumask_var(&top_cpuset.cpus_allowed, GFP_KERNEL)); in cpuset_init()
2125 cpumask_setall(top_cpuset.cpus_allowed); in cpuset_init()
2159 while (cpumask_empty(parent->cpus_allowed) || in remove_tasks_in_empty_cpuset()
2178 cpumask_copy(cs->cpus_allowed, new_cpus); in hotplug_update_tasks_legacy()
2188 if (cpus_updated && !cpumask_empty(cs->cpus_allowed)) in hotplug_update_tasks_legacy()
2193 is_empty = cpumask_empty(cs->cpus_allowed) || in hotplug_update_tasks_legacy()
2258 cpumask_and(&new_cpus, cs->cpus_allowed, parent_cs(cs)->effective_cpus); in cpuset_hotplug_update_tasks()
2317 cpumask_copy(top_cpuset.cpus_allowed, &new_cpus); in cpuset_hotplug_workfn()
2400 cpumask_copy(top_cpuset.cpus_allowed, cpu_active_mask); in cpuset_init_smp()